Family friendly hiking trails around Wentorf bei Hamburg are characterized by a blend of natural features, including rivers, extensive forests, and dedicated nature reserves. The region is situated on the Bille River and borders the Sachsenwald forest, providing diverse landscapes for outdoor activities. Numerous parks and green spaces contribute to its verdant character, offering well-maintained paths suitable for various fitness levels.

There are over 90 hiking routes in the Wentorf bei Hamburg area, with more than 60 of them classified as easy, making them ideal for families. These trails offer a wonderful way to explore the diverse landscapes, from river valleys to dense forests.
The region around Wentorf bei Hamburg is rich in natural beauty. You'll find picturesque rivers like the Bille, tranquil lakes such as Eichbaum Lake, and extensive forested areas including the Sachsenwald. Several nature reserves, like the Billetal and Wentorfer Lohe, offer well-maintained paths through varied terrain.
Yes, many trails are designed as loops, perfect for families. For example, the Billetal Nature Reserve – Reinbek Castle and Park loop from Reinbek is an easy 4.5 km route that takes you through scenic nature and past the historic Reinbek Castle. Another great option is the Panzerberg Wentorfer Lohe – Wentorfer Lohe Nature Reserve loop, which is just under 4 km and very accessible.

Absolutely! Many trails offer points of interest. The Billetal Nature Reserve loop passes directly by the impressive Reinbek Castle. You might also encounter scenic viewpoints like Theodor-Wulff Hill, or explore the unique Dalbekschlucht Nature Reserve Trails, known for its gorge.

While many trails are easy, some natural paths might be uneven. However, the region offers several well-maintained, wider paths, including sections of the former Marschbahndamm railway line, which has been converted into a pleasant cycle and pedestrian path. These flatter, shaded routes are often suitable for strollers and can be enjoyed by families seeking smoother surfaces.

The Tank Hill, Wentorfer Lohe – Wentorfer Lohe Nature Reserve loop from Reinbek is an excellent choice. This easy 7.6 km route takes you through the beautiful nature reserve, offering a chance to experience its diverse flora and fauna, and is suitable for families looking for a slightly longer, yet still manageable, adventure.
Yes, the area is known for its rivers and lakes. The Bergedorf Brewery Ponds – Bille Bridge at the Brewery Ponds loop from Reinbek is a lovely 5.1 km easy hike that takes you along the scenic Brewery Ponds and crosses the Bille River, offering beautiful waterside views perfect for families.
